Soren, did you fix your problem? From what you're sayin the X from the console
does not seem to be able to contact the XDM on your server. One way I usually
debug such problems quickly is to launch X manually from a console.
In your lts.conf change your SCREEN_01 for:
SCREEN_01 = shell

Sometimes this problem has to do with DNS too. Make
sure the DNS settings are correct. Sometimes the grey
screen will go away and XDM/GDM will kick in after a
few minuets of inactivity.
